About

The Master of Arts in Philosophy of Law Governance and Politics is a two-year, full-time on-campus program that delves into the philosophical foundations of law, governance, and political theory. The program explores the relationship between law and politics, the ethical dimensions of governance, and the philosophical debates that shape modern legal systems and political ideologies. Students will engage with topics such as justice, rights, democracy, and political power.

Graduates will be well-prepared for careers in legal theory, policy analysis, and government advisory roles. Leiden University offers access to expert faculty, rich academic resources, and practical engagement with political and legal institutions. This program equips students with the analytical tools necessary for addressing contemporary challenges in law and politics.

Program Structure

Semester 1 – Foundations in Philosophy of Law and Politics

  • Introduction to Philosophy of Law
  • Political Philosophy and Legal Theory
  • Governance Models and Legal Institutions
  • Research Methods in Philosophy of Law

Semester 2 – Advanced Philosophy of Law and Politics

  • Constitutional Law and Democracy
  • Ethics in Governance and Political Systems
  • Philosophy of International Law
  • Research Project in Philosophy of Law and Governance

Semester 3 – Applied Philosophy of Law and Politics

  • Human Rights and Social Justice
  • Comparative Politics and Legal Systems
  • Philosophical Approaches to Conflict and Resolution
  • Research Project in Applied Philosophy of Law

Semester 4 – Master’s Thesis & Final Project

  • Independent Research / Thesis
  • Data Analysis in Philosophy of Law and Politics
  • Presentation & Academic Portfolio Development
